Transaction 1151c4a54ae2fcb320012c8f76ff4f883e9b8edc39a3c073a9ee7eace55d57f3
1 Input
2 Outputs
- 1151c4a54ae2fcb320012c8f76ff4f883e9b8edc39a3c073a9ee7eace55d57f3:0
- 1151c4a54ae2fcb320012c8f76ff4f883e9b8edc39a3c073a9ee7eace55d57f3:1
value 27365418
address 1KXucDp7qMi8extYHKtNuUQGKS4Lq7sXfT
value 40000000
address 3Lkgzh4wHi3t24W6oh58TR1SfsDYhz7SCf